  12. def id: String

    This unique id of this function.

    This unique id of this function.

    It is stored in the database and should be unique to each function.

    This can simply be the full class name if your application does not have conflict package names and class names.

    NOTE - Missing functions are reported/logged along with this id to make debugging easier.

    returns

    a unique id for each function.
